Made appears in inspection records nine times, starting in 2022. On Mar 11, 2026, the health department conducted the most recent visit. High risk indicates the latest inspection turned up problems worth knowing about.

Things have been moving the wrong way, with the rolling count rising from around three violations to closer to five violations per visit.

Across the inspection history, “handwash sink not accessible for employee use” is the issue that surfaces most often, recorded two times.

That's lower than the typical Sarasota restaurant, which scores around 81. There are enough flags in the record to merit a second thought.

High Priority - Operating with an expired Division of Hotels and Restaurants license. **Admin Complaint**
50-17-3
High Priority - Time/temperature control for safety food cold held at greater than 41 degrees Fahrenheit. Cheddar cheese (58F - Cold Holding); Cooked eggs (56F - Cold Holding); Stored stacked above the pan fill line in the top section of the reach in cooler on the cook line. Employee stated the items had been stored in the reach in cooler for approximately 1 hour. Employee placed the items in the bottom section of the reach in cooler. **Corrective Action Taken**
03A-02-5
High Priority - Raw animal foods not properly separated from each other in holding unit based upon minimum required cooking temperature. Raw ground beef stored over raw pork in the walk in cooler. Owner removed the ground beef. **Corrected On-Site**
08A-20-5
Intermediate - Handwash sink not accessible for employee use at all times. Hand wash sink next to the cook line block by a speed rack. Owner removed the speed rack. **Corrected On-Site**
31A-09-4
Intermediate - Food-contact surface soiled with food debris, mold-like substance or slime. Mixer head soiled.
22-02-4
Intermediate - No soap provided at handwash sink. No soap provided at the hand wash sink next to the ice machine. Owner placed soap at the hand wash sink. **Corrected On-Site**
31B-03-4
Intermediate - Ready-to-eat, time/temperature control for safety food prepared onsite and held more than 24 hours not properly date marked. Cooked potatoes stored in the walk in cooler with no date make. Owner stated the potatoes were cooked on 3/7. Owner placed a date mark on the pita. **Corrected On-Site**
02C-02-5
Basic - Cutting board has cut marks and is no longer cleanable. Large cutting board on the cook line.
14-09-4
Basic - Interior of oven/microwave has accumulation of black substance/grease/food debris. Interior of the convection oven on the cook line soiled.
22-08-4
Basic - Wiping cloth chlorine sanitizing solution not at proper minimum strength. Wiping cloth sanitizer reading 00ppm chlorine. Owner replaced the sanitizer, new reading 75ppm chlorine. **Corrected On-Site**
21-07-4
